Whole Grain Tuna Macaroni Salad

Ingredients

  • 1 package of multi grain elbow macaroni
  • 1 can tuna, drained
  • 2 stalks celery,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ons chopped red onion
  • 1 small bag of frozen baby peas, cooked according to package directions
  • 3 hard boiled eggs, chopped
  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tablespoons dill relish
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Paprika for garnish

Instructions

  1.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add the macaroni, and cook until tender. Drain and set aside..
  2. In a large bowl, stir together the tuna, celery, onion and peas. Mix in the mayonnaise, relish, salt and pepper. Add the macaroni and egg and garnish with paprika. Cover and chill for at least 1 hour before serving.
